Tony Molelekoa has instructed his lawyers to slap three women with a R300K damages claim.

Mpumalanga premier Refilwe Mtsweni-Tsipane’s secretary has instructed his lawyers to slap three women with a R300,000 damages claim for allegedly spreading “malicious” rumours that he is the premier’s stepson.

“They have been spreading the lies about me and I do not even know them from a bar of soap. This cannot go without consequence because it impugns my professional integrity. It raises the issue of nepotism without any basis,” he said. He is seeking R100,000 in damages from each of the women, whose names are known to The Citizen, and he said the action was not about money.

“I do not even know how long it [the allegation] has been on social media because I am not active on that platform. What I can say is that once it came to my attention early last month, I decided to take action because it not only impacts my professional reputation but that of the premier as well,” he said.
